Do not be fooled by the game of Elon Musk, who denounces a threat to which he contributes, because fake news has proliferated on Twitter since he took control. This game also promotes the interests of his company Neuralink. This one wants to put implants in our brains on the grounds of keeping control over the machines, but comes up against the refusal of a license from the FDA (Food and Drug Administration) [l’autorité de santé américaine]. By barely caricaturing the style of science fiction to which he has accustomed us, he agitates the threat of a Terminator, an instrument of authoritarianism, so that we let him manufacture his Robocop, a supposedly more intelligent cyborg.

The European Parliament should immediately summon Elon Musk and audition him in Brussels, then his counterparts from other Big Techs. The message of the leader of Tesla expresses a desire for cooperation between public and private, of which act, and the magnitude of the threat justifies the urgent construction of parades against misinformation.

The first parry is to identify misinformation. We already know that the main cause of the danger comes from the programming mode of the AI, which leads to a “black box” whose results no one, not even programmers, can explain. Malicious or military use of this tool therefore escapes the control of its designers.
